‘Twilight: Breaking Dawn – Part 2’ Opens with $30.4 Million from Midnight Screenings

The Twilight Saga: Breaking Dawn – Part 2 is out of the gates and off an running as the final chapter in the “saga” brought in an estimated $30.4 million from late Thursday and Friday midnight screenings, narrowly topping The Twilight Saga: Breaking Dawn – Part 1, which brought in $30.25 million from midnights last year. Part 1 went on to bring in $138.1 million domestically in its opening weekend and finished with $705.1 million worldwide.

Around $30 million seems to be the ceiling for this franchise when it comes to opening midnighters as Eclipse brought in $30 million as well and the $700 million range seems to be the worldwide capper with Eclipse finishing just shy with $698.5 million and The Twilight Saga: New Moon still the highest grossing of the franchise to date with $709.8 million. New Moon also holds the opening weekend record for the franchise at $142.8 million, can this final installment top that? It’s opening in 46 more theaters and franchise finales are always big business.
